vuejs config несколько источников данных - PullRequest
0 голосов
/ 12 сентября 2018

У меня есть две таблицы данных в приложении VUE.

  • Наличные [код, описание, наличные]
  • Загрузить [банк, id]

Для функции обновления мне нужно взять [банк, id] из загрузки и [наличные] из наличных. я не знаю как, может кто-нибудь помочь, пожалуйста? Спасибо. Это мой код:

  var app = new Vue({
el: '#app',
data: {
cash: {
        codeentry:'',
        description:'',
        cash:'',      
 },
 upload: {
        bank:'',
        id:'',       
 },
 methods: {               
 updateBank:function(){
     axios.put('/updatebank', this.upload)
            .then(response => {
                if (response.data.etat) {
                    this.upload = {
                        id:response.data.etat.id,
                        bank:response.data.etat.bank,
                    };
                       this.cash = {
                          cash: response.data.etat.cash,      
                    };  
                }

            })
            .catch(error => {
                console.log('errors: ', error)
            })
    },
    }
    });

1 Ответ

0 голосов
/ 13 сентября 2018

Вы можете изменить функцию в своем бэкэнде так, чтобы она принимала объект, содержащий как выгрузку, так и наличные, поэтому первая строка вашего updateBank метода во внешнем интерфейсе будет выглядеть так:

axios.put('/updatebank', { this.upload, this.cash })
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...